in education. Come join us, and let's make change together. - Job
Description This role will lead and direct the activities of the
revenue accounting team to record and report revenue based on and
in accordance with USGAAP. - The position requires a highly
motivated individual with a proven background in revenue accounting
models (software revenue recognition and ASC 606). The position
also requires a fundamental knowledge and experience with month end
close procedures, and controls, analytics, foreign currency issues
and working with external auditors.This is a Global leadership
position within a fast-growing, dynamic business and as such there
will be an expectation that the individual appointed will have a
genuine focus on continuous improvement and the gravitas to drive
improvements across the Company's key business processes.
-Responsibilities: -
- Lead and manage the revenue accounting team in day-to-day
revenue recognition methods for accounting and reporting
- Communicate and work alongside key stakeholders including
FP&A
- Review and approve all final revenue reconciliations and
technical calculations.
- Be the key senior contact for the internal and external
auditors to ensure real time collective support on approach to
given matters.
- Optimising processes and controls across the revenue process,
enhancing current procedures and implementing new ones to drive
improvements.
- Provide support and guidance to the sales, legal, and
operations teams during contract negotiations and reviews in the
areas of revenue recognition
- Manage full cycle general ledger financial close process for
revenue and related activities to ensure complete and accurate
financials in accordance with U.S. GAAP, including managing and
reviewing close activities such as journal entries and account
reconciliations within the established close timeline
- Develop and maintain the performance of the team directly and
indirectly through Team Leaders, including recruiting, coaching,
performance management and developing the team as is needed.
- The Global leader for ASC 606, ensuring compliance across all
revenue streams, bundles and customer/partner/reseller
arrangements.
- A technical expert on the subject of revenue recognition, you
will educate the business on this topic and develop your team to
follow in your footsteps.
- Perform ad-hoc management related requests and analysis
Qualifications
- Bachelor's Degree from an accredited institution
- Qualified Accountant (ACA, CIMA, ACA, CPA)
- 5+ years experience with US GAAP, in particular evidence of
experience with ASC 606
- 5+ years of experience managing staff
- Strong effective communication skills at all levels of the
business, including c-suite
- Tech savvy with proven experience of working in NetSuite
- Experience of working for a SAAS Company preferred -
- Strong solution-oriented leadership skills with a demonstrated
ability to influence management and contributors at all levels of
the organization and across functions
- Experience of working within a complex US corporate structure
